“Josh Sweat” is trending because late offseason NFL trade/roster speculation is circulating around the Arizona Cardinals edge rusher, including reports about interest from teams like the Green Bay Packers. (sports.yahoo.com) The buzz is being amplified by how tradeable his contract is perceived to be, with multiple outlets pointing to the established deal terms and cap structure. (nfl.com) As teams map out pass-rush needs ahead of the new league calendar, even rumors about one starting-caliber defensive end can spike searches. (sports.yahoo.com)
